Final update on this. I was able to pull another disk image that is working fine. The main difference was that I used 512k bs for the dd as opposed to 1024k (what I had done the first time). I just thought I'd throw that out in case anyone else ever runs into something like this.

Would there be a boot loader error? > > > > > Use tomsrtbt (www.toms.net/rb, and find the tomsrtbt.raw > > floppy image). > > > > Boot with > > qemu -fda tomsrtbt.raw -hda win95.img -boot a > > then try to do a > > fdisk -l /dev/hda > > if you see your partition, mount it. If everything is in place (the > > boot flag, and so on) this is a win95 boot issue. (go to > > www.bootdisk.com to join a boot floppy for win95) > > If fdisk complains, the win95.img is not a harddisk image. > > That's a clever way to look at it, and it's clearly not a normal > partition table, so I think that's a good clue for what I need to do to > look into this.
